Introduction In the world of healthcare, processing clinical text plays a crucial role in efficiently documenting patient information and providing accurate diagnoses. However, manual extraction of relevant data and assigning appropriate ICD codes can be time-consuming and prone to errors. In this article, we will explore how AutoICD, an automated clinical text processing tool, revolutionizes the process and boosts efficiency in the healthcare industry. The Power of AutoICD Streamlining Data Extraction AutoICD utilizes advanced natural language processing (NLP) algorithms to extract relevant information from clinical text. By analyzing medical reports, notes, and other textual data, AutoICD automatically identifies key details, such as symptoms, diagnoses, treatments, and medications, minimizing the need for manual extraction. This streamlines the process and saves valuable time for healthcare professionals. Accelerating ICD Coding Assigning appropriate ICD codes to clinical text is a critical task for accurate billing, reporting, and statistical analysis. AutoICD employs machine learning techniques to automatically suggest ICD codes based on the extracted information. This significantly speed up the coding process, reduces human error, and ensures consistency in coding practices. How AutoICD Boosts Efficiency Time-Saving Benefits The automation provided by AutoICD dramatically reduces the time required for clinical text processing. Healthcare professionals no longer need to manually review and extract information from each document, allowing them to allocate their time and resources to more critical tasks, such as patient care and treatment planning. Enhanced Accuracy and Consistency Manual processing of clinical text is prone to errors and inconsistencies. AutoICD's advanced algorithms minimize the risk of human mistakes and ensure consistent coding practices. This leads to improved accuracy in diagnoses, treatment documentation, and reporting, benefiting both healthcare providers and patients.
